The Shift from "Nice-to-Have" to "Need-to-Have"
If you walked into a classroom ten years ago, STEM was often a "special" Friday afternoon activity. Fast forward to 2026, and the landscape has completely shifted. STEM is no longer a standalone subject; it’s the framework through which all other subjects are taught.
But why the sudden surge in investment? Why are school boards and administrators prioritizing budgets for 3D printers and robotics kits over traditional textbooks?
1. Preparing for the AI-Driven Workforce
By 2026, AI is no longer a futuristic concept—it’s an everyday tool. Schools realize that to prepare students for careers in the next decade, they must move beyond rote memorization. Today’s students need to understand how to collaborate with machines, debug code, and think in systems. Beyond the Basics: The "A" in STEAM
In 2026, we’ve also seen the widespread adoption of STEAM (adding 'Arts' to the mix). This interdisciplinary approach teaches students that technical skills like coding or engineering are most powerful when combined with creative design.
For example, a student might use a 3D printer to build a drone (Engineering/Math) but must also apply principles of design thinking to ensure the product is user-friendly and aesthetically functional (Art).
